2. Jiangxi Tianqi Jintaige Cobalt Co., Ltd. (formerly Longnan Jintaige Cobalt Co., Ltd.). Founded in 2008, the company specializes in the field of battery recycling, mainly engaged in the comprehensive recycling of lithium batteries, with electronic-grade cobalt oxide, industrial-grade cobalt oxide, cobalt sulfate, electrodeposited copper and other products, with strong capacity to deal with waste lithium batteries.
3. Guangdong Guanghua Technology Co., Ltd. is an advanced professional chemical service provider, integrating product research and development, production, sales and service. The company focuses on the cascade utilization and recycling of high-performance electronic chemicals, high-quality chemical reagents, special chemicals for production lines, new energy materials and retired power batteries, and provides customized development and technical services for other professional chemicals.
4. Ganzhou Peng Hao Technology Co., Ltd. (hereinafter referred to as "Ganzhou Peng Hao"). Located in Shuixi Park, Zhanggong High-tech Industrial Park, Ganzhou City, Jiangxi Province. The company is a holding subsidiary of Xiamen Tungsten Industry, a listed company in Shanghai Stock Exchange. Its shareholders include Xiamen Tungsten Industry Co., Ltd., Shenzhen Peng Hao Technology Co., Ltd. and BAIC New Energy Automobile Co., Ltd. ..
